Transaction 31b3370016bf7ec54f5bd843a8492a350fbca8b0e5039aa4c1e62dc9601a59aa
1 Input
1 Output
-
31b3370016bf7ec54f5bd843a8492a350fbca8b0e5039aa4c1e62dc9601a59aa:0
- value
- 8070435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9473d75240190d967c1a9691f627a63b209b8f05 OP_EQUALVERIFY OP_CHECKSIG
- address
- LYku3PFvgkC9SSuE3fTEt2zZEuzuLN1hNs